LDAP proxy for AD -- still no solution



Hi All,

I progressed further, but still haven't reached stage where I can use AD account.

Through, the proxy setup I could able to query ldap, but unable to use it for authentication. For example,

ldapsearch -x -h ldapserver -LLL -b d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au '(uid=nazeerm)'

is Successful, but id nazeerm fails (returns id: nazeerm: No such user).

Here is ldap.conf file on client machine.


uri ldap://ldapserver.research.phg.com.au/
base d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au
scope sub
bind_timelimit 15
timelimit 15
ssl no
referrals no
nss_base_passwd d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au?sub
#nss_base_passwd OU=Da Vinci Coders,OU=Portland House,OU=Sites,d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au?one
#nss_base_passwd cn=users,d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au?one
nss_base_shadow d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au?sub
nss_base_group d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au?sub?&(objectCategory=group)(gidnumber=*)

nss_map_objectclass posixAccount user
nss_map_objectclass shadowAccount user
nss_map_objectclass posixGroup group

nss_map_attribute gecos cn
nss_map_attribute homeDirectory unixHomeDirectory
nss_map_attribute uniqueMember member
nss_initgroups_ignoreusers root,ldap

I could able to successfully use proxy functionality to connect to an AD server using the slapd configuration below.

[SNIPPET from slap.conf]
database        ldap
suffix          "OU=Da Vinci Coders,OU=Portland House,OU=Sites,DC=internal,DC=phg,DC=com,DC=au"
subordinate
rebind-as-user
uri             "ldap://192.168.100.100/";

acl-bind
        bindmethod=simple binddn="CN=Ldap       Authentication,OU=Linux,OU=InformationTechnology,OU=Portland    House,OU=Sites,DC=internal,DC=phg,DC=com,DC=au"         credentials="test"

chase-referrals yes

idassert-bind   bindmethod=simple
                authzID="u:bind"
                mode=self
                binddn="CN=Ldap Authentication,OU=Linux,OU=InformationTechnology,OU=Portland House,OU=Sites,DC=internal,DC=phg,DC=com,DC=au"
                credentials="test "

idassert-authzFrom "dn.regex:.*"



I want to use the users under the above suffix (OU=Da Vinci Coders) as users for Linux clients.

At present I cannot see them (e.g command, su - nazeerm fails) as they NOT are under " cn=users,d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au" or " cn=people,d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au".

Is there any easy of mapping    "OU=Da Vinci Coders,OU=Portland House,OU=Sites,DC=internal,DC=phg,DC=com,DC=au" to " cn=users,dc=internal,dc=phg,dc=com,dc=au ".
